    THE BIG: Located in Woodinville. Long Shadows has this tasting room in the Redwood Place that…read moreshares the same walls with Mark Ryan, Fidelitas, and Latta. Plenty of parking in the lot. THE BLACK AND WHITE: This was our second winery stop and we wanted to do a quick wine flight and go onto the next winery. We got the mixed wine flight that included a rose, sauv blanc, and three red blends. The sauv blanc was very nice and all the red blends were good to round out the tasting. I'd say my favorite sip from the red blend was the Sequel. Service was great and was able to walk us through the story behind each wine. THE FINAL BAMBOO: Ultimately a flight of 5 wines was around $30. Wines tasted great and service was impeccable.
